How Exam Marks Are Counted
For many practical examinations, the bulk of the marks are given towards main pieces. Often these represent over 50% of the overall mark; after all, this is where your music making skills comes to life. These are the pieces you’ve spent months preparing and you know like the back of your hand; so, it makes sense that all this work would play heavily into the outcome. You can get away with a low score in the technical exercises if your repertoire’s on fire! The weight of performance section will help cushion any poor showing elsewhere.
In contrast, there is the technical work: scales, arpeggios etc. These tend to be the lighter part of the examination but more important for future development. If your pieces is strong then a poor score here will not necessarily fail you, but it points toward something that needs improvement at its foundations. Perhaps you have a high weighted score but a low technical score, which reveals an imbalance in your skills.

Statistically speaking, sight-reading and aural tests can be far more problematic than their worth. Often weighted at a modest ten percent each in many systems, they are typically not the part of the exam that could potentially damage your chances. If everything else is good then a poor showing in the sight-reading will lose you a couple of percentage points at most.
What students fear about these components is that they are unpredictable. The examiner may ask an unfamiliar interval or play a piece of music you have never seen before. You cannot do anything to prepare for these things, so they seem much bigger in the student’s mind than their actualy effect on the final result.
You should also consider higher level examinations and University Juries. Here the panel’s impression, or the jury rubric can hold considerable weight. It isn’t just about the accuracy of notes but also musicianship, tone quality and even stage presence. This is where you’re making an argument for importance of the music. Keep in mind that there are real world threshold settings to consider. Sixty percent isn’t necessarily the pass line for everything, and you may need to get at least a certain mark in particular areas regardless of your average. For instance, although a student might have got an overall percentage of 90 percent, if their marks were below a set minimum in any of the scales, then they would of failed. This is one reason it’s so useful to check exactly what your examination body requires before you assume that a weighted average can be used alone. Crucially though, it’s not about hitting a number. It’s about seeing where you’re strengthening your ability and where you’re weak. If there is a high score in ‘performance’ and a low score in ‘technical’, that is a worrying split. It might indicate that you are passing exams without building the skill to handle harder works later on. Perfect technique paired with a flat performance could mean that although you are technically fine, you aren’t playing with any musicality.
